Enrico Dimitrow is a scholar working on Biophysics,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Enrico Dimitrow has authored 6 papers receiving a total of 312 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Biophysics, 4 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 4 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Enrico Dimitrow's work include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(6 papers),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(4 papers) and Optical Coherence Tomography Applications (3 papers). Enrico Dimitrow is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(6 papers),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(4 papers) and Optical Coherence Tomography Applications (3 papers). Enrico Dimitrow collaborates with scholars based in Germany and United States. Enrico Dimitrow's co-authors include Karsten König, Peter Elsner, Martin Kaatz, Johannes Norgauer, Martin Johannes Koehler, Mirjana Ziemer, Alexander Ehlers, Iris Riemann, Rainer Bückle and R. Le Harzic and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Investigative Dermatology, Experimental Dermatology and Proceedings of SPIE, the International Society for Optical Engineering/Proceedings of SPIE.

All Works

6 of 6 papers shown
1.
Dimitrow, Enrico, Mirjana Ziemer, Martin Johannes Koehler, et al.. (2009). Sensitivity and Specificity of Multiphoton Laser Tomography for In Vivo and Ex Vivo Diagnosis of Malignant Melanoma. Journal of Investigative Dermatology. 129(7). 1752–1758. 169 indexed citations
2.
Dimitrow, Enrico, Iris Riemann, Alexander Ehlers, et al.. (2009). Spectral fluorescence lifetime detection and selective melanin imaging by multiphoton laser tomography for melanoma diagnosis. Experimental Dermatology. 18(6). 509–515. 127 indexed citations
3.
Riemann, Iris, Alexander Ehlers, R. Le Harzic, et al.. (2008). Non-invasive analysis/diagnosis of human normal and melanoma skin tissues with two-photon FLIM in vivo. Proceedings of SPIE, the International Society for Optical Engineering/Proceedings of SPIE. 6842. 684205–684205. 4 indexed citations
4.
Riemann, Iris, Katja Schenke‐Layland, Alexander Ehlers, et al.. (2006). High-resolution multiphoton optical tomography of tissues: an in vitro and in vivo study. Proceedings of SPIE, the International Society for Optical Engineering/Proceedings of SPIE. 6142. 61420N–61420N. 1 indexed citations
5.
König, Karsten, Iris Riemann, Alexander Ehlers, et al.. (2006). In vivo multiphoton tomography of skin cancer. Proceedings of SPIE, the International Society for Optical Engineering/Proceedings of SPIE. 6089. 60890R–60890R. 8 indexed citations
6.
Riemann, Iris, Enrico Dimitrow, Martin Kaatz, et al.. (2005). In vivo multiphoton tomography of inflammatory tissue and melanoma. Proceedings of SPIE, the International Society for Optical Engineering/Proceedings of SPIE. 5686. 97–97. 3 indexed citations
